I have a '98 SLK230. I had driven cars with Xenon HID lights and love them. The SLK
does not come with HID lamps, but I saw conversion kits for $1000 or so. I was ready to buy one of these kits but then I read that the lens on the outside of the car is made for the current bulb, and replacing it with a different bulb would screw up the beam pattern...even if the new bulb were .025" off. There is a $ back gaurantee on the HID kits. Can anyone give me advice??? These kits are the same balasts and HID lamps as the factory would install; I'm more worried about the beam pattern.

I have never seen a completely successful conversion on a mercedes. The mercedes option is a several thousand dollar option for the Xenon bulbs. This is because it has a controlling unit, ballast, bulbs and auto-leveling device. This is more than the scope of most aftermarket units. If anyone has seen a truly successful(matching OEM specs and functionality) conversion then let us know.
